How does an ultrasonic cool mist humidifier work?

An ultrasonic cool mist humidifier works by using high-frequency sound waves to convert water from a liquid into a fine mist. This process, known as cavitation, creates tiny droplets of water that are released into the air, effectively increasing the humidity in the surrounding environment.The device consists of two main parts: an ultrasonic generator and a wicking filter or reservoir. The ultrasonic generator produces the high-frequency sound waves that create the mist, while the reservoir holds the water and allows it to be wicked up by the filter, which is then released into the air as a cool mist. This type of humidifier is quiet, energy-efficient, and easy to clean, making it a popular choice for many households, especially those with babies and young children who may be sensitive to loud noises or dry air.

What are the benefits of using a humidifier for babies with congestion and colds?

Using a humidifier for babies with congestion and colds can provide several benefits. A humidifier helps to maintain a healthy moisture level in the air, which can relieve nasal passages and make it easier for babies to breathe. This is especially helpful when dealing with congestion caused by colds, as excess mucus can be cleared more efficiently when the air is adequately moisturized.By using a humidifier, parents can also reduce their baby's discomfort and promote better sleep quality. The constant dripping sound of a humidifier can create a soothing atmosphere, helping to calm their baby down and making it easier for them to fall asleep. Additionally, some humidifiers come with built-in features like nightlights, essential oil diffusers, or quiet operation, which can further enhance the overall experience.

Can I use a humidifier to relieve coughs in my baby?

Yes, you can use a humidifier to relieve coughs in your baby, but it's essential to choose the right type and follow safety guidelines.A cool mist humidifier, like the Frida Baby 3-in-1 XL Top Fill Humidifiers, is often recommended for babies because they release a gentle vapor that won't irritate their sensitive skin or nasal passages. However, make sure to use distilled water in the humidifier to prevent bacterial growth and keep your baby safe from potential infections. Additionally, always supervise your baby when using a humidifier, and follow the manufacturer's instructions for proper operation and maintenance.
